2025-03-27 15:05:14 +08:00

228 lines
7.3 KiB
C#

using System.Runtime.Serialization;
namespace SuperMap.RealEstate.Personnel.Running.Interface
{
#region T_TRAIN ITRAIN
/// <summary>
/// T_TRAIN 接口
/// </summary>
public interface ITRAIN
{
/// <summary>
/// 培训内码
/// </summary>
System.Int32? TRAIN_ID { get; set; }
/// <summary>
/// 培训内码 的加密字符串
/// </summary>
string TRAIN_ID_Encrypt { get; set; }
/// <summary>
/// 流程内码
/// </summary>
System.Int32? PERSONNELPROINST_ID { get; set; }
/// <summary>
/// 培训标题
/// </summary>
System.String TRAIN_TITLE { get; set; }
/// <summary>
/// 培训内容
/// </summary>
System.String TRAIN_CONTENT { get; set; }
/// <summary>
/// 培训开始日期
/// </summary>
System.DateTime? TRAIN_DATE { get; set; }
/// <summary>
/// 培训结束日期
/// </summary>
System.DateTime? TRAIN_ENDDATE { get; set; }
/// <summary>
/// 培训人员内码集合
/// </summary>
System.String TRAIN_STAFFIDS { get; set; }
/// <summary>
/// 培训人员
/// </summary>
System.String TRAIN_PERSON { get; set; }
/// <summary>
/// 培训结果
/// </summary>
System.String TRAIN_RESULT { get; set; }
/// <summary>
/// 创建时间
/// </summary>
System.DateTime? CREATE_DATE { get; set; }
/// <summary>
/// 备注说明
/// </summary>
System.String TRAIN_DESC { get; set; }
}
#endregion
#region T_TRAIN IModifyTRAIN
/// <summary>
/// T_TRAIN 接口
/// </summary>
public interface IModifyTRAIN
{
/// <summary>
/// 培训内码 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_ID { get; set; }
/// <summary>
/// 流程内码 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_PERSONNELPROINST_ID { get; set; }
/// <summary>
/// 培训标题 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_TITLE { get; set; }
/// <summary>
/// 培训内容 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_CONTENT { get; set; }
/// <summary>
/// 培训开始日期 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_DATE { get; set; }
/// <summary>
/// 培训结束日期 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_ENDDATE { get; set; }
/// <summary>
/// 培训人员内码集合 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_STAFFIDS { get; set; }
/// <summary>
/// 培训人员 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_PERSON { get; set; }
/// <summary>
/// 培训结果 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_RESULT { get; set; }
/// <summary>
/// 创建时间 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_CREATE_DATE { get; set; }
/// <summary>
/// 备注说明 是否被修改,不建议直接对其赋值操作
/// </summary>
bool Modify_TRAIN_DESC { get; set; }
}
#endregion
#region T_TRAIN
/// <summary>
/// T_TRAIN_培训信息表 的字段类
/// </summary>
public class TableSchema_TRAIN
{
/// <summary>
/// 序列名 (用于Oracle主键)
/// </summary>
public const string SequenceName = "seq_train";
/// <summary>
/// 表名
/// </summary>
public const string TableName = "T_TRAIN";
/// <summary>
/// 表注释
/// </summary>
public const string Comment_TableName = "培训信息表";
/// <summary>
/// 主键
/// </summary>
public const string KeyFieldName = "TRAIN_ID";
/// <summary>
/// 培训内码
/// </summary>
public const string TRAIN_ID = "TRAIN_ID";
/// <summary>
/// 流程内码
/// </summary>
public const string PERSONNELPROINST_ID = "PERSONNELPROINST_ID";
/// <summary>
/// 培训标题
/// </summary>
public const string TRAIN_TITLE = "TRAIN_TITLE";
/// <summary>
/// 培训内容
/// </summary>
public const string TRAIN_CONTENT = "TRAIN_CONTENT";
/// <summary>
/// 培训开始日期
/// </summary>
public const string TRAIN_DATE = "TRAIN_DATE";
/// <summary>
/// 培训结束日期
/// </summary>
public const string TRAIN_ENDDATE = "TRAIN_ENDDATE";
/// <summary>
/// 培训人员内码集合
/// </summary>
public const string TRAIN_STAFFIDS = "TRAIN_STAFFIDS";
/// <summary>
/// 培训人员
/// </summary>
public const string TRAIN_PERSON = "TRAIN_PERSON";
/// <summary>
/// 培训结果
/// </summary>
public const string TRAIN_RESULT = "TRAIN_RESULT";
/// <summary>
/// 创建时间
/// </summary>
public const string CREATE_DATE = "CREATE_DATE";
/// <summary>
/// 备注说明
/// </summary>
public const string TRAIN_DESC = "TRAIN_DESC";
/// <summary>
/// 培训内码
/// </summary>
public const string Comment_TRAIN_ID = "培训内码";
/// <summary>
/// 流程内码
/// </summary>
public const string Comment_PERSONNELPROINST_ID = "流程内码";
/// <summary>
/// 培训标题
/// </summary>
public const string Comment_TRAIN_TITLE = "培训标题";
/// <summary>
/// 培训内容
/// </summary>
public const string Comment_TRAIN_CONTENT = "培训内容";
/// <summary>
/// 培训开始日期
/// </summary>
public const string Comment_TRAIN_DATE = "培训开始日期";
/// <summary>
/// 培训结束日期
/// </summary>
public const string Comment_TRAIN_ENDDATE = "培训结束日期";
/// <summary>
/// 培训人员内码集合
/// </summary>
public const string Comment_TRAIN_STAFFIDS = "培训人员内码集合";
/// <summary>
/// 培训人员
/// </summary>
public const string Comment_TRAIN_PERSON = "培训人员";
/// <summary>
/// 培训结果
/// </summary>
public const string Comment_TRAIN_RESULT = "培训结果";
/// <summary>
/// 创建时间
/// </summary>
public const string Comment_CREATE_DATE = "创建时间";
/// <summary>
/// 备注说明
/// </summary>
public const string Comment_TRAIN_DESC = "备注说明";
}
#endregion
}